When comparing trading costs for Liberia traders, BlackBull Markets offers variable spreads starting from 0.0 pips on its ECN account, with a commission per lot, making it cost-effective for high-volume traders. Trade Nation provides fixed spreads, which are predictable but slightly higher, averaging around 1.0 pip on major pairs. For traders in Liberia dealing in USD, BlackBull Markets can reduce costs significantly if you trade frequently, while Trade Nation's fixed spreads suit those who prefer no surprises. Remember that trading volume impacts overall expenses, so consider your typical lot size when choosing.

BlackBull Markets offers MetaTrader 4 and MetaTrader 5, both powerful platforms with advanced charting tools, automated trading, and custom indicators. This is ideal for Liberia traders who need robust analysis features. Trade Nation uses its proprietary web-based platform, which is clean, intuitive, and perfect for beginners or those who prefer simplicity. While BlackBull Markets supports third-party plugins and EA trading, Trade Nation focuses on ease of use with one-click trading and clear risk management tools. Your choice depends on whether you need advanced functionality or a straightforward experience.

BlackBull Markets uses Equinix NY4 data centers for ultra-fast execution, with no requotes on ECN accounts, making it ideal for scalpers and algorithmic traders. Trade Nation offers market execution with no dealing desk intervention, ensuring transparency but slightly slower speeds. For Liberia traders, BlackBull Markets' execution quality is superior for high-frequency strategies, while Trade Nation's execution is reliable for standard trading.

Both BlackBull Markets and Trade Nation off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ts for Muslim traders in Liberia who need to comply with Sharia law. These accounts eliminate overnight interest charges on positions held beyond the trading day. BlackBull Markets provides swap-free accounts on its ECN and Standard accounts, while Trade Nation offers them on all account types. Liberia traders should request this account during registration, as it is not automatically applied. Both brokers ensure that swap-free accounts cover most forex pairs and CFDs, though some instruments may incur administrative fees.
